자율운항 선박 시장 규모는 최근 몇 년간 크게 성장했습니다. 2025년 82억 4,000만 달러에서 2026년에는 87억 4,000만 달러에 이르고, CAGR 6.0%로 성장할 전망입니다. 지난 몇 년간의 성장 요인으로는 해운 자동화 테스트, 해상 안전 향상, 연료 효율에 대한 수요, 초기 단계의 자율 항해 시스템, 디지털 해운 업무 등을 들 수 있습니다.

자율운항 선박 시장 규모는 향후 몇 년간 강력한 성장이 전망되고 있습니다. 2030년에는 112억 2,000만 달러에 이르고, CAGR은 6.5%를 보일 전망입니다. 예측 기간 동안 이러한 성장은 자율운항선박에 대한 규제적 지원, 스마트 항만 인프라 확대, 탈탄소화 목표, AI를 활용한 해상 분석, 자율운항선대 최적화 등이 요인으로 작용할 것으로 보입니다. 예측 기간의 주요 동향으로는 완전 자율운항 선박의 개발, 원격 선대 운영 도입, AI 충돌 회피 시스템 통합, 전기 자율운항 선박의 성장, 스마트 포트의 확대 등을 꼽을 수 있습니다.

인위적인 실수로 인한 해양사고 증가는 막대한 경제적 손실을 초래하고 있으며, 이는 자율운항선박 시장의 성장을 견인할 것으로 예측됩니다. 자율 기술을 탑재한 무인 선박은 인위적인 실수로 인한 사고를 미연에 방지하고, 선내 사고와 그에 따른 비용을 절감할 수 있습니다. 예를 들어, 2023년 7월 영국 정부 기관인 해난조사국(MAIB)은 약 700명의 선원들이 9만 6,000회 이상의 승선 및 하선을 위해 조종사 사다리를 사용했으며, 그 결과 400건 이상의 사고가 발생했다고 보고했습니다. 이 중 25%는 사이드 로프를 고정할 때 롤링 히치 대신 걸쇠를 사용했기 때문이고, 23%는 사다리의 재질 상태 불량으로 인한 것이며, 13%는 난간 기둥이 불충분했기 때문에 발생했습니다. 따라서 인적 실수와 경제적 손실을 최소화하기 위한 자율운항선박의 도입이 향후 몇 년 동안 시장 성장을 견인할 것으로 예측됩니다.

자율운항선박 시장의 주요 기업들은 보다 안전하고 효율적이며 규정을 준수하는 자율운항 선박에 대한 수요 증가에 대응하기 위해 AI를 활용한 실시간 상황 인식 및 항해 시스템 등 기술 혁신에 집중하고 있습니다. 예를 들어, 2024년 9월, 한국에 본사를 둔 해양 AI 및 항해 솔루션 개발 기업 씨드로닉스는 SMM 2024 해양 박람회에서 첨단 'True-AI' 선박 모니터링 및 항해 시스템 'NAVISS 2.0'을 발표하였습니다. 이 시스템은 여러 선상 센서(카메라, 레이더, LiDAR 등)를 통합하여 선박 주변을 360도 '전방위'로 원활하게 파악할 수 있는 '어라운드 뷰'를 제공함으로써 실시간 조감도를 구현합니다. NAVISS 2.0은 씨드로닉스만의 VADAR(VaDA AI Detection and Ranging) 기술을 활용하여 해상 물체를 감지 및 분류하고, 충돌 위험이 확인되면 음성 경고 및 화면 팝업으로 알려줍니다. 또한, 선종 및 항해 상황에 따라 맞춤형 디스플레이 옵션도 제공합니다. 인간 감시, 레이더 또는 AIS(자동 선박 식별 시스템)에 의존하는 기존 항해 방식에 비해 AI 기반 솔루션은 사각지대를 줄이고 인적 오류를 최소화하며 혼잡한 수로, 활기찬 항구 또는 시야가 좋지 않은 상황에서의 안전성을 향상시킵니다. 이번 출시는 자율운항을 지원하는 AI 기반 상황 인식에 대한 수요 증가와 국제해사기구(IMO)의 해상 자율운항 선박 코드(MASS 코드) 등 향후 규제 준수에 대응하기 위한 전략적인 노력으로 평가받고 있습니다.

Autonomous ships are vessels that operate and navigate without direct human control, employing advanced technologies like artificial intelligence, sensors, and automated systems to improve safety, efficiency, and sustainability in maritime operations.

The autonomy within the market for autonomous ships encompasses full autonomy, remote operations, and partial autonomy. Partially autonomous ships denote vessels that prioritize safety and operate through artificial intelligence, mitigating the risk of ship accidents. Propulsion options include fully electric or hybrid systems. The range of fuel options encompasses carbon-neutral fuels, LNG, electricity, and heavy fuel oil/marine engine fuel. The end-users in this market consist of both commercial and defense sectors.

Tariffs are impacting the autonomous ships market by increasing the cost of imported navigation sensors, control systems, propulsion electronics, communication hardware, and energy storage systems. Commercial shipping and defense sectors in North America and Europe are particularly affected due to reliance on imported autonomous ship technologies, while Asia-Pacific shipbuilders face pricing pressure on exports. These tariffs are raising vessel development and retrofitting costs. However, they are also encouraging regional shipyard modernization, local technology integration, and innovation in modular autonomous ship architectures.

The autonomous ships market size has grown strongly in recent years. It will grow from $8.24 billion in 2025 to $8.74 billion in 2026 at a compound annual growth rate (CAGR) of 6.0%. The growth in the historic period can be attributed to shipping automation trials, maritime safety enhancement, fuel efficiency demand, early autonomous navigation systems, digital maritime operations.

The autonomous ships market size is expected to see strong growth in the next few years. It will grow to $11.22 billion in 2030 at a compound annual growth rate (CAGR) of 6.5%. The growth in the forecast period can be attributed to regulatory support for autonomous shipping, smart port infrastructure growth, decarbonization targets, AI-based maritime analytics, autonomous fleet optimization. Major trends in the forecast period include development of fully autonomous vessels, remote fleet operation adoption, integration of ai collision avoidance, growth of electric autonomous ships, expansion of smart ports.

The rising number of marine accidents caused by human errors, leading to significant financial losses, is expected to drive the growth of the autonomous ship market. Unmanned ships equipped with autonomous technology help prevent accidents caused by human errors, reducing onboard incidents and associated costs. For instance, in July 2023, the Marine Accident Investigation Branch (MAIB), a UK-based government agency, reported that nearly 700 marine pilots conducted over 96,000 transfers using pilot ladders, resulting in more than 400 incidents. Of these, 25% were due to shackles being used instead of rolling hitches to secure side ropes, 23% were caused by poor ladder material condition, and 13% occurred because handhold stanchions were inadequate. Therefore, the adoption of autonomous ships to minimize human errors and financial losses is expected to drive market growth in the coming years.

Major companies in the autonomous ships market are focusing on technological innovations, such as real-time AI-powered situational awareness and navigation systems, to meet the rising demand for safer, more efficient, and regulation-compliant autonomous vessel operations. For instance, in September 2024, Seadronix, a South Korea-based developer of maritime AI and navigation solutions, launched NAVISS 2.0, an advanced "True-AI" ship monitoring and navigation system at the SMM 2024 maritime trade fair. This system integrates multiple onboard sensors (cameras, radar, LiDAR, etc.) to provide a seamless 360-degree "around-view" of the ship's surroundings, delivering a real-time bird's-eye perspective. NAVISS 2.0 uses Seadronix's proprietary VADAR (VaDA AI Detection and Ranging) technology to detect and classify maritime objects, issue voice alerts and on-screen pop-ups when collision risks are identified, and offer customizable viewing options for different vessels or navigation contexts. Compared to traditional navigation methods reliant on human watch-standing, radar, or AIS (Automatic Identification System), this AI-driven solution reduces blind spots, minimizes human error, and enhances safety in congested waterways, busy ports, or poor visibility conditions. The launch was positioned as a strategic response to growing demand for AI-driven situational awareness supporting autonomous navigation and compliance with forthcoming regulations such as the IMO maritime autonomous surface ships code (MASS Code).

In July 2023, Nabtesco Corporation, a Japan-based company known for a range of engineering solutions, including the production of gearboxes, rotors, motors, and robotics, acquired Deep Sea Technologies, Inc. for an undisclosed amount. This acquisition facilitates the integration of Deep Sea's advanced AI technologies, especially its software platforms such as Cassandra for monitoring vessel performance and Pythia for optimizing voyages. These tools assist shipping companies in minimizing fuel consumption and emissions, supporting global sustainability objectives. Deep Sea Technologies, Inc., based in the US, specializes in engineering and manufacturing products and equipment for subsea oil and gas field development projects.

Asia-Pacific was the largest region in the autonomous ships market in 2025. Western Europe was the second largest region in the autonomous ships market share. The autonomous ship market consists of sales of autonomous container ships, maritime autonomous surface ships (MASS), and crewless vessels. Values in this market are factory gate values, that is the value of goods sold by the manufacturers or creators of the goods, whether to other entities (including downstream manufacturers, wholesalers, distributors, and retailers) or directly to end customers. The value of goods in this market includes related services sold by the creators of the goods.

The market value is defined as the revenues that enterprises gain from the sale of goods and/or services within the specified market and geography through sales, grants, or donations in terms of the currency (in USD unless otherwise specified).

The revenues for a specified geography are consumption values that are revenues generated by organizations in the specified geography within the market, irrespective of where they are produced. It does not include revenues from resales along the supply chain, either further along the supply chain or as part of other products.
